越来越多的编程语言应运而生。SVF(Simple Virtual Function)编程语言作为其中的一员,因其独特的优势受到了广泛关注。本文将从SVF编程语言的定义、特点、应用场景等方面进行探讨,旨在为广大读者揭示SVF编程语言的魅力。

一、SVF编程语言概述

1. 定义

SVF编程语言是一种用于编写智能合约的编程语言,旨在实现区块链技术的安全性、高效性和易用性。它基于虚拟机模型,具有简洁、高效、易于学习的特点。

SVF编程语言探索区块链技术的未来

2. 特点

(1)简洁性:SVF编程语言采用了一种类似自然语言的语法,使得开发者可以轻松上手。

(2)安全性:SVF编程语言对智能合约进行严格的静态检查,降低了合约漏洞的风险。

(3)高效性:SVF编程语言采用虚拟机模型,具有较高的执行效率。

(4)易用性:SVF编程语言具有丰富的库函数和开发工具,降低了开发难度。

二、SVF编程语言的应用场景

1. 智能合约

SVF编程语言在智能合约领域具有广泛的应用前景。通过SVF编写的智能合约可以应用于数字货币、供应链管理、版权保护、物联网等领域。

2. 跨境支付

SVF编程语言可以应用于跨境支付领域,实现快速、安全、低成本的跨境支付。

3. 供应链金融

SVF编程语言可以应用于供应链金融领域,提高融资效率,降低融资成本。

4. 版权保护

SVF编程语言可以应用于版权保护领域,确保创作者的权益得到有效保障。

三、SVF编程语言的未来展望

随着区块链技术的不断发展,SVF编程语言有望在以下方面取得更大突破:

1. 优化性能:通过持续优化虚拟机模型,提高SVF编程语言的执行效率。

2. 扩展应用场景:进一步拓展SVF编程语言的应用领域,如医疗、教育、公益等。

3. 提高安全性:不断优化合约检查机制,降低智能合约漏洞风险。

4. 降低开发门槛:推出更多易于上手的开发工具和库函数,降低开发者学习成本。

SVF编程语言作为区块链技术领域的一颗新星,具有独特的优势。在未来,SVF编程语言有望在智能合约、跨境支付、供应链金融、版权保护等领域发挥重要作用。让我们共同期待SVF编程语言的辉煌未来!

参考文献:

[1] 张三,李四.区块链技术及其应用[J].计算机科学,2018,45(2):1-10.

[2] 王五,赵六.智能合约编程语言研究[J].计算机应用与软件,2019,36(5):1-8.

[3] 孙七,周八.SVF编程语言在智能合约中的应用[J].软件导刊,2020,19(3):1-5.